Resumo
This paper deals with an inter-annotatoragreementtestinvolving the identificationof the information unit of topicas defined within the framework oftheLanguage into Act Theory(L-AcT). Fleiss’skappa statisticwas used to measure the agreementamong the four anno-tatorswho took partin the test.The dataused was sampledfromC-ORAL-BRASIL II, a spontaneous speech corpusof Brazilian Portuguese.The paper beginsbyoutliningof the theoretical underpinnings of L-AcT,dedicating special attention toaspects directly related tothe notion of Topic. Section 2presentsthepilot testanddiscussesmethodological and theoretical issues that were relevant for the designoftheprotocol that was eventually used in the actual test.Sections3and 4dealwiththe test, its protocol and results(the kappa coefficient for the general agreement was 0.79, whichby usual standards representsasub-stantialagreement).Section 5firstprovides abrief review of a fewstudiesconducted ac-cording to other frameworkswhichhave dealt withinter-annotatoragreement onthe an-notation of information structure categories. Finally,the errors observed in the test are analyzed qualitatively.
